Transaction 31183029e1b25d5e1a84a29db2eb23780235f061a69e2e55ca22e17ac899faec

1 Input
2 Outputs
  • 31183029e1b25d5e1a84a29db2eb23780235f061a69e2e55ca22e17ac899faec:0
  • value  1240002
    address  3HwppaWGvDabrdoYTNCPjutfeuPMPQbbYg
  • 31183029e1b25d5e1a84a29db2eb23780235f061a69e2e55ca22e17ac899faec:1
  • value  1588484
    address  3EvynPnKHstJTLwVeEavYJzzfwNjaHjkjj